Problems solved by technology

Therefore, if the amount of heat dissipation from the target component cannot be estimated while taking into account the temperature of peripheral components located around the target component, there is a possibility that the temperature of the target component cannot be accurately estimated after the drive of the motor is stopped.

[0034] Below, according to Figure 1 to Figure 11 An embodiment embodying the present invention will be described. Such as figure 1 as well as figure 2 As shown, the electronic device of this embodiment is a brake hydraulic unit 12 that is driven to adjust the braking force applied to a wheel 11 mounted on a vehicle. The brake hydraulic unit 12 includes a motor 20, a substantially rectangular parallelepiped housing (equipment component) 30 to which the motor 20 is attached, and is fixed at a position different from the mounting position of the motor 20 in the housing 30 (in this case, In the embodiment, the storage box 40 at the position on the opposite side).

[0035] The motor 20 of this embodiment is a DC motor with brushes. Abstract

The invention relates to a temperature estimating device and a temperature estimating method.A temperature estimating unit includes an energy calculating unit that calculates a heat generation energy rate of a motor on the basis of a difference between power input to the motor and power output from the motor, a heat radiation energy calculating unit that calculates a heat radiation energy rate from a target member on the basis of a difference between a previous temperature estimation value Tm of the target member and an ambient temperature, and a thermal coefficient of the target member, and an amount calculating unit that calculates a temperature increase rate of the target member on the basis of a difference between the heat generation energy rate and the heat radiation energy rate, and an estimation value calculating unit that calculates a current temperature estimation value of the target member on the basis of the temperature increase rate and the previous temperature estimation value.

Description

technical field [0001] The present invention relates to a temperature estimating device and a temperature estimating method for estimating the temperature of device components constituting an electronic device including a motor. Background technique [0002] Conventionally, an electric power steering apparatus described in Patent Document 1, for example, has been proposed as an electronic device including a motor. This patent document 1 discloses a method of calculating an estimated value of the temperature increase amount of the motor without using a sensor for detecting the temperature of the motor. Specifically, the estimated value (Δθ) of the temperature increase amount of the motor is calculated based on the relational expression (Expression 1) shown below.
